Question regarding your reception decor. You said you brought allot of candles with you.. did you need to rent holders? That's where I'm finding my centerpiece expense to be.

I'm glad you had such a wonderful time!

The votives already had glass holders that came with them, so they were not a problem. I had them all over the tables and steps and around the border of the pool. They were really nice. I wish I would have brought more. But, I thought 300 would be plenty...wrong. I guess you can never have too many.

I brought mirror glass holders to set the pillar candles on. But what I really needed was a glass hurricane. The pillars kept blowing out. But honestly, it was a minor problem. I dont think people payed too much attention. I would have just not brought these. But they looked nice on the table!
